Below you can see the block diagram of a basic PWM Class-D amplifier, just like the one that we are building. The input signal is converted into a pulse width modulated, rectangular signal using a comparator. This basically means that the input is encoded into the duty cycle of the rectangular pulses.

A typical Class D power amplifier consists of a sawtooth waveform generator, comparator (based on an OPAMP), switching circuit, and a low pass filter. The block diagram of a Class D amplifier is shown in the figure below. Sawtooth waveform generator.

Let's see the circuit diagram of class D amplifier. Circuit diagram of class D amplifier. To build this amplifier we need to generate a triangular waveform. For this we will use operational amplifiers. Then we need a comparator to compare the triangular waveform and audio signal. Then we need a NOT gate to invert the PWM pulses.

Circuit diagram. Class D amplifier circuit BD5460 Notes. The power supply voltage can be between 2.5 to 6.5V DC. For the circuit shown here, the supply voltage must be 3.6 V DC. Powering the circuit from a battery is the better option because it reduces noise. If you are using a DC power supply, then it must be well regulated and filtered.

This simplified functional block diagram illustrates a basic half-bridge Class D amplifier. Figure 2. The output-signal pulse widths vary proportionally with the input-signal magnitude. In order to extract the amplified audio signal from this PWM waveform, the output of the Class D amplifier is fed to a lowpass filter.

A class D amplifier operates by deriving a two-state signal from a continuous control signal and amplifying it using power switches. At the core of every class D amplifier is at least one comparator and one switching power stage. In all but the lowest-cost power amplifiers, a passive LC filter is added. Class-D Vs.
